Show that at very low energy permanent dipole effect should dominate, and polarization interaction takes over at higher energy. Show that the energy at which dipole interaction changes to polarization is about 0.01 eV (less than 0.025 eV – thermal energy at 300 K) for CO and NO, and 2.3 eV for water molecules. (Thus, only for water molecules with very high dipole moments, ion scattering by a dipole is relevant at ‘normal’ and higher temperatures.)
